Teri Barbera, spokes- woman for the Palm Beach County Sheriff's Office, confirmed that Epstein, 55, has been in the workcrelease program since Oct. 10. “He works six days a week: Friday through Wednesday 10 am. to 10 pm.,” Barbera said via e-mail. “(He) works at his local West Palm Beach ‘ office, monitored on an active GPS system (he wears an ankle bracelet). Mr Epstein hires a permit deputy, at his expense, for his own security at his workplace during the time he is out.” Miami attorney Jeffrey Herman represents six young women who've sued Epstein, claiming he sexually abused them at his Palm Beach home when they were minors. Herman said he received a letter about the workre- lease program from the US. Attorney's Office within the past few days. Epstein pleaded guilty June 30 to two felony counts: soliciting prostitution and procuring’a person under 18 for prostitution.
